## ✨ Features

- ➕ **Addition** - Add two numbers
- ➖ **Subtraction** - Subtract second from first
- ✖️ **Multiplication** - Multiply two numbers
- ➗ **Division** - Divide first by second (with zero division error handling)
- 🏠 **Floor** - Floor division (integer result)
- 🔢 **Modulo** - Remainder after division
- ⚡ **Exponent** - Raise first number to the power of second
- √ **Square Root** - Square root of a number
- ⁿ√ **Nth Root** - Nth root of a number
- 🔢 **Percentage** - Calculate percentage of a number
- ❗ **Factorial** - Factorial of a number
- 🔢 **Floating-point precision** - 0.1 + 0.2 = 0.3 (we fixed it!)
- 🛡️ **Error handling** - Division by zero? We got you
- ⌨️ **Regex quit patterns** - `q`, `Q`, `quit`, `QUIT`, `12`
- 📊 **Calculation counter** - Track your math history
- 🎨 **Beautiful formatting** - Clean, color-coded output
- 💡 **Built-in help** - Type `h` or `help` for documentation
- 🧠 **Keyboard interrupts** - Ctrl+C gracefully handled

## 🚀 Usage

### Interactive Mode (Recommended)

```python
from nexuscalc import start_calc
start_calc()
```

Or using the wrapper:

```python
from nexuscalc import nexuscalc
nexuscalc.start_calc()
```

Or after installation, just run:

```bash
nexuscalc
```

### Read the README from Terminal

```python
from nexuscalc import readme
readme()
```

### Programmatic Usage

```python
from nexuscalc.core.operations import Operations

ops = Operations()

# Basic operations
result = ops.add(5, 3)           # Returns 8
result = ops.subtract(10, 4)     # Returns 6
result = ops.multiply(3, 4)      # Returns 12
result = ops.divide(10, 2)       # Returns 5.0

# Advanced operations
result = ops.floor_divide(10, 3) # Returns 3
result = ops.modulo(10, 3)       # Returns 1
result = ops.exponent(2, 3)      # Returns 8 (2^3)
result = ops.square_root(16)     # Returns 4.0 (√16)
result = ops.nth_root(8, 3)      # Returns 2.0 (³√8)
result = ops.percentage(20, 100) # Returns 20.0
result = ops.factorial(5)        # Returns 120
```

## 🎮 Interactive Commands

While using the calculator, you can type:

| Command | Action |
|---------|--------|
| `1` | Add ➕ |
| `2` | Subtract ➖ |
| `3` | Multiply ✖️ |
| `4` | Divide ➗ |
| `5` | Floor 🏠 |
| `6` | Modulo 🔢 |
| `7` | Exponent ⚡ |
| `8` | Square Root √ |
| `9` | Nth Root ⁿ√ |
| `10` | Percentage % |
| `11` | Factorial ! |
| `12`, `q`, `Q`, `quit`, `QUIT` | Exit calculator |
| `h`, `help`, `?` | Show help |
| `Ctrl+C` | Cancel current operation |
| `Ctrl+D` | Exit calculator |

## 🛡️ Error Handling

NexusCalc handles errors gracefully:

```python
# Even root of negative number
NEXUSCALC > 9
Enter the number
NEXUSCALC > -8
Enter the root (n)
NEXUSCALC > 2

❌ Error: Cannot take even root of a negative number!

# Factorial of negative number
NEXUSCALC > 11
Enter a number
NEXUSCALC > -5

❌ Error: Factorial is not defined for negative numbers!

# Division by zero
NEXUSCALC > 4
Enter first number
NEXUSCALC > 10
Enter second number
NEXUSCALC > 0

❌ Division Error: Cannot divide by zero!
💡 Hint: You cannot divide by zero. Please try a different number.
```
